Top definition
That first moment when the thought crosses your mind, "I think I have to pee".
I was so close to drifting off to sleep when I got the tinkle-inkling. As tired as I was, I knew peeing then would let me sleep later in the morning.
by lyvancic December 15, 2010
Get the mug
Get a tinkle-inkling mug for your friend Vivek.